Where do you put an indoor fly trap?

Place traps inside the facility near (but not in front of) each outside door and opening window. Consider other light sources that might compete with the trap. Don’t place ILTs in brightly lit areas. For day-flying insects like house flies, install wall-mount or corner-mount light traps low.

Where should I hang my fly strips?

Go to a spot where flies gather and the tube can hang freely. It’s best to place the ribbon in a spot where the ribbon can hang freely, not against a wall. That way, you can catch flies from all directions. Door openings, awnings, sheds, and tree branches are all viable locations.

Where do you put fly zapper?

Fly killers should be positioned between potential entry points (windows, doorways, etc) so as to intercept flying insects before they get to sensitive or undesirable areas. Height also plays a big part in ideal positioning. Do not install fly killers either too high or too low in the area to be protected.

Where is the best place to put an electric fly killer?

Above doors: The ideal position for your fly killer should be between the most likely point of entry and the food. Therefore, just inside and above doors is common, as insects are lured away from prep areas without being enticed into the building.

How do you attract flies to a fly strip?

Flies like sunshine and light in general. When using fly glue traps or paper you will want to hang the paper in a sunny part of the room either near a window or door. Flies also prefer higher parts of a room where the temperature is warmer. So hang your fly traps up high where flies are naturally drawn.

How far away should a bug zapper be?

15-20 feet away
Position unit at least 15-20 feet away from areas where your friends and family are likely to be. Our bug zappers also work best when hung 5-7 feet from ground-level. Hanging your bug zapper on a tree or shepherd hook (which you can buy at hardware / home improvement stores) works best.
